ALT_DEFINITION
  • A procedure that uses high-frequency sound waves (ultrasound) to create an image of the heart under conditions such as exercise, pharmacologic agents or pacing intended to elicit signs and symptoms of myocardial ischemia.CDISC

DEFINITION
  • An image of the heart produced by ultrasonography under conditions intended to elicit signs and symptoms of myocardial ischemia. Conditions often include exercise, pharmacologic agents or pacing.NCI
